To the XIV century, it’s been a long time since Mongol army got dressed in trophies from raids, as Chingisids set up production of Mongol-Tatar armor on the commercial scale in the conquered regions with high level of handicraft industry.
Iranian miniatures are a real goldmine of information of how medieval plate armour Khudesutu Khuyag was looking like in the XIII-XV centuries.
Essentially, types of Mongol armor could be divided by materials (hard and soft) and by design (cuirass-like and vest-like models).
Our today’s hero is a cuirass-like Khudesutu Khuyag with spaulders and skirt-tasses. It has been carefully reconstructed by painting sources from Iran, China and Japan. By the way, tracing early versions of this armor, we could not but pay attention to the Old Turkic cuirass. It had been found in the burial site Balyk-Sook, which is located in the valley of Ursul River (Central Altai). Armor is dated by the VIII – early IX centuries.
This lamellar armor had been assembled of separate elements, made of lamellas. Full set included shoulders, front protector and backplate, fastened with shoulder belts and side fastenings, and a belt, supporting tasses.
